共用方式為


Span<T>.Slice 方法

定義

多載

Slice(Int32)

從目前範圍形成從指定索引開始的配量。

Slice(Int32, Int32)

從指定長度的指定索引開始,形成目前範圍的配量。

Slice(Int32)

來源:
Span.cs
來源:
Span.cs
來源:
Span.cs

從目前範圍形成從指定索引開始的配量。

public:
 Span<T> Slice(int start);
public Span<T> Slice (int start);
member this.Slice : int -> Span<'T>
Public Function Slice (start As Integer) As Span(Of T)

參數

start
Int32

要開始配量之以零起始的索引。

傳回

範圍,包含目前範圍的所有專案,從 start 到範圍結尾。

例外狀況

start 小於零或大於 Length

適用於

Slice(Int32, Int32)

來源:
Span.cs
來源:
Span.cs
來源:
Span.cs

從指定長度的指定索引開始,形成目前範圍的配量。

public:
 Span<T> Slice(int start, int length);
public Span<T> Slice (int start, int length);
member this.Slice : int * int -> Span<'T>
Public Function Slice (start As Integer, length As Integer) As Span(Of T)

參數

start
Int32

要開始此配量之以零起始的索引。

length
Int32

配量所需的長度。

傳回

範圍,由目前範圍從 start開始的 length 專案所組成。

例外狀況

startstart + length 小於零或大於 Length

適用於